Influence of the 2016 Kumamoto earthquake on groundwater quality

Abstract

<p> We investigated the influence of the 2016 Kumamoto earthquake on groundwater quality at 12 sampling points in the area near its seismic centre. We statistically evaluated the difference in the measured values of each water-quality index before and after the earthquake based on bi-weekly or monthly monitoring data for three years across the earthquake area. We also visualised water-quality characteristics using a hexa-diagram (Stiff diagram) and statistically evaluated differences before and after the earthquake using non-hierarchical cluster analysis. The results showed that there was not a large variation in water-quality characteristics as represented by the hexa-diagram shape. However, statistical analysis showed a significant difference at nine sampling points, suggesting earthquake influence on groundwater quality. In addition, it is possible that the influence of the earthquake appeared later in a groundwater-discharge area. On the other hand, no topographic relationship between the location of the sampling points and seismic centre or the fault was shown; thus, it is likely that groundwater quality varied at arbitrary points within the study area where slip on the fault was observed.</p>
